A gold-catalyzed oxidative reaction
of propargylic carbonates or
acetates using 3,5-dichloropyridine as the oxidant has been developed.
The reaction provides efficient access to α-functionalized-α,β-unsaturated
ketones with excellent regio- and diastereocontrol via a regioselective
attack of the N-oxide to the gold-activated alkyne
followed by a 1,2-carbonate migration. In addition, the alkene products
could be further transformed into the valuable 5-hydroxycyclopent-2-enones
via cyclocondensation with acetone or cyclodimerization under basic
conditions.
